2008 Audi A4 vs. 1993 Jaguar XJ
To start off, 2008 Audi A4 is newer by 15 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1993 Jaguar XJ.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1993 Jaguar XJ would be higher. At 5,993 cc (12 cylinders), 1993 Jaguar XJ is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1993 Jaguar XJ (318 HP @ 5400 RPM) has 157 more horse power than 2008 Audi A4. (161 HP @ 5700 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1993 Jaguar XJ should accelerate faster than 2008 Audi A4.
Because 1993 Jaguar XJ is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1993 Jaguar XJ.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Audi A4,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1993 Jaguar XJ (464 Nm @ 3750 RPM) has 239 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Audi A4. (225 Nm @ 1950 RPM). This means 1993 Jaguar XJ will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Audi A4.
